Banana Nut Bread
Did you know, you can freeze your over ripe bananas and use them later with this EASY Banana Bread Recipe. You will Love the Moist, Sweet Bread from all these bananas. The Riper the Banana, the better.

  • Servings: 1 Loaf

Ingredients

  • (450 Grams) Very Ripe Bananas
  • (1/2 Cup) Vegetable Oil
  • (100 Grams) Sugar
  • (100 Grams (Cracked Eggs)) 2 Large EGGS
  • (1 TSP) Vanilla
  • (120 Grams) All Purpose Flour
  • (1/2 TSP) Sea Salt
  • (1 TSP) Baking Soda
  • (1/4 TSP) Nutmeg
  • (1/2 TSP) Cinnamon
  • (65 Grams (and a little extra for the topping)) Chopped Pecans

Directions

This recipe can be made by hand in mixing bowls or a stand mixer.  


Everything in Place:
  Gather up all your ingredients. 

First, Combine the Wet Ingredients:

Mash the bananas / or mix in the stand mixer

Add the Eggs, Vanilla, Vegetable oil and Sugar (Mix until well combined)

Next, whisk together the dry ingredients:

In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, salt, cinnamon and nutmeg.

Add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ients...

Mix until just combined. IMPORTANT! be careful not to overmix or your bread will be dense.

Fold the Pecans into the Batter.

You are now ready to Bake!

Grease your bread pan with a little oil to prevent sticking

Transfer the batter to the loaf pan and sprinkle pecans on top.  (I personally like to cover the entire top of my bread with pecans)

Bake at 350 for about 60 Minutes or until a toothpick inserted comes out clean.

Baking Tip:  Check the bread halfway through.  If the top is well browned but the loaf still needs more time, cover it with foil making a tent to allow for the bread to rise without touching the foil.  

For a Moist loaf, it is Important to weigh your ingredients and don't cut yourself short on the bananas.
